iOS软件外包是如今很流行的一种方式,它极大地节约公司成本和时间,特别对于中小型企业来说更加实用。但很多公司对iOS外包流程产生了疑问,不知道从何处入手。本文为大家详细讲解了iOS软件外包的整个流程,以依兰iOS软件外包流程为例,帮助公司了解外包的具体流程及注意事项,方便公司寻找合适的外包伙伴,从而顺利完成iOS外包项目。
1. 寻找合适的外包公司
选择一家专业的iOS外包公司非常重要,这是保证项目进度和后期成果的关键所在。公司可以根据自己的项目需求、外包公司的经验和服务、技术团队的素质等多方面因素来进行全面考虑,并在此基础上选择一家合适的公司进行合作。
2. 确定项目需求和工期
在确定外包公司后,下一步就是要确定项目需求以及开发周期,以便外包公司可以安排相关人员进行开发。同时,还要保证双方的沟通顺畅,确保外包公司明确项目需求和开发周期的具体要求,以避免后期出现不必要的矛盾。
3. 签订合同
在明确项目需求和开发周期后,双方应当进行正式签约,约定好工作内容、工作费用、工作时间等相关条款。此外,合同中还应明确保密协议和责任承担等内容,以确保项目的安全和后续维护工作的高效进行。
4. 沟通和交流
在开发过程中,双方需进行充分的沟通和交流,及时了解项目进展和问题,以确保项目在规定时间内开发完成。一般来说,双方每周应至少进行一次会议来监控整个项目的进展情况,以及调整出现的问题。
5. 测试和验收
开发完成后,外包公司需要进行充分的测试,确保软件的质量和可用性。测试完成后,需进行验收,双方确认软件的功能和性能达到了预期效果,才可以正式交付和上线使用。同时,外包公司还应及时处理项目开发过程中产生的漏洞,并对可能出现的风险进行预判和应对。
结尾段落:
通过本文的详细介绍,相信大家已经了解了iOS软件外包的整个流程以及注意事项。选择一家专业的iOS外包公司、明确项目需求和开发周期、签订正式合同、充分沟通交流、测试验收等步骤都是非常关键的。只有在这些步骤上做足准备,并在实际实践中注重细节和方法,才能顺利完成整个项目并获取到预期的成果。
iOS软件开发已经成为现代软件开发领域的一部分,很多公司采用了iOS软件外包的方式来降低开发成本。依兰iOS软件外包流程就是很好的一种方式,秉承着规范化、标准化的开发流程高效地完成各类人员之间的协作。本文从零开始,详解依兰iOS软件外包的流程,帮助初学者更好地理解这一领域。
1、概述
依兰iOS软件外包流程从项目的需求分析、产品设计、开发实现、测试部署、维护支持几个方面,完整地展现了一款iOS软件应该具备的全部流程。其中,开发实现是整个流程中最关键和最基础的一部分,它决定了项目的质量和效率。
2、需求分析
在iOS软件外包流程中,需求分析的阶段是很重要的,因为这个时候会确定项目的目的、范围、功能、需求、风险等,让所有涉及到项目的人员都了解了项目的整体情况。在这个阶段,我们要考虑到市场需求,分析竞品,寻找差异化的需求点,提升用户体验。
3、产品设计
产品设计需要根据需求分析阶段的结果,通过对产品特点、应用场景等方面的考虑,识别用户需求,制定出合理的设计方案。在iOS软件外包流程中,产品设计是切实可行的,要根据目标用户来区分用户的画像,并制定符合用户需求的设计方案,从而提高应用的使用价值和竞争能力。
4、开发实现
开发实现是依兰iOS软件外包流程的核心阶段之一。在开发的实现阶段中,需要选用符合iOS开发的领先技术,在保证代码质量的同时,还要保证代码逻辑的正确性和业务复杂度的可控性,使产品可以顺利完成开发阶段而达到预期的效果。
5、测试部署
在开发实现阶段完成后,需要进行测试部署的阶段,对应用的各种功能进行细致而严密的测试。只有经过严格的测试,才能保证软件的质量。在测试阶段需要有清晰的流程规范,并制定出详细的测试计划、测试用例,并通过复杂的测试方法来控制测试的成本。
以上五个阶段,就是依兰iOS软件外包流程的核心内容之一,只要根据流程认真分析,并相应的完善流程,就能够生产出优质的iOS软件,满足市场的需求,推进公司的发展。因此,在iOS软件外包的行业中,高效的流程管理是必要的,只有规范化和标准化的流程才能提高软件外包服务商的技术能力和市场竞争力。